If you've ever walked through the woods at night and thought "I wish this was scarier'', Alexandra has the answer.

The Walk of Scare will be frightening any willing person aged 8 to 18 from 6pm tonight.

The Alexandra and Districts Youth Trust-run event will be held in an area northwest of the town known as The Pines.

The Alexandra Lions Club will set up a cafe there and the Grim Reaper will lead anyone game enough to the start of a maze.

Participants will then follow lights through the trees, bracing themselves along the way.

Youth worker Jess Laurent said a group of young people got together and decided on the scariest things they could think of.

"The Grim Reaper will also lead them out of the maze, if they make it out alive.''

There would be eight different horror themes in the maze, but the group did not want to give too much away, she said.

A junior youth council was created in Alexandra this year as part of the trust and was given the task of organising events.

Vanya Rouse-Henry (14), of Alexandra, said she and her friends would be hiding in the maze to scare people in various ways.

The event will be staggered, with years 5-6 children starting at 6pm, years 7-8 at 7pm and years 9-13 at 8pm. Entry costs $2.

Participants are advised to bring a torch and wear covered shoes and warm clothes. Children under 12 must be accompanied by a parent or guardian.
